Mobile Entertainment Forum elects new EMEA board

MEFThe Mobile Entertainment Forum has elected a new board for its EMEA business at this week's general meeting. Gerrit Jan Konijnenberg of Comfone was re-elected as Chairman, with Mark Kortekaas from the BBC and Qtel’s Colin Yeh re-elected as Co-Vice Chairmen.

The MEF board now consists of:

Chairman: Gerrit Jan Konijnenberg (EVP Strategic Development, Comfone)

Co-Vice Chairman: Mark Kortekaas (FM Controller Audio & Mobile, BBC)

Co-Vice Chairman: Colin Yeh (Head of Group Product Development, Qtel)

Jiella Esmat (Director Digital Expansion, Sony Pictures Home Entertainment)

Barry Houlihan (CEO & Founder, Mobile Interactive Group(

Jonathan Jowitt (Senior Technical Marketing Manager, Dolby)

Emma Kaye (Director, Mira Networks)

Javier Lorente (Global Project Manager, Telefonica)

Mark Ollila (Director of Publishing, Games & Services, Nokia)

Dominique Rougie (TV/Video Director, Next.com/Orange)

Raghu Venkataraman (Executive VP, Chief Strategy & Investments Officer, du)

Chairman Emeritus & Founder: Gerard Grech (Head of Content, Media and Games, Nokia)

The Mobile Entertainment Forum was established ten years ago as a global trade body for the mobile media and entertainment industry.
